WebOct 20, 2024 · Bone spurs that form along the spine can result in an impingement in which a nerve is compressed by the bone overgrowth. In such a case, there can be pain felt in multiple parts of the body depending on which nerve line was affected. WebA Bone spurs are protrusions of bone that grow along the edges of the bone. Bone spurs also called (osteophytes) usually form where bones meet each other in your joints. They could also form on the bones of your spine. The main cause of bone spurs is joint damage related to osteoarthritis.

WebOct 11, 2024 · Bone spurs can rub against the rotator cuff, which controls shoulder movement. This can lead to shoulder tendinitis and can even tear the rotator cuff. Spine. Bone spurs on the spine can cause spinal stenosis, or the narrowing of the spinal canal, pain, and loss of motion.
